- /*=============================================================================
- Copyright (c) 2001-2013 Joel de Guzman
- Distributed under the Boost Software License, Version 1.0. (See accompanying
- file LICENSE_1_0.txt or copy at http://www.boost.org/LICENSE_1_0.txt)
- =============================================================================*/
- #include <string>
- #include <vector>
- #include <set>
- #include <map>
- #include <boost/detail/lightweight_test.hpp>
- #include <boost/spirit/home/x3.hpp>
- #include <string>
- #include <iostream>
- #include "test.hpp"
- #include "utils.hpp"
- using namespace spirit_test;
- int
- main()
- {
- using namespace boost::spirit::x3::ascii;
- {
- BOOST_TEST(test("a,b,c,d,e,f,g,h", char_ % ','));
- BOOST_TEST(test("a,b,c,d,e,f,g,h,", char_ % ',', false));
- }
- {
- BOOST_TEST(test("a, b, c, d, e, f, g, h", char_ % ',', space));
- BOOST_TEST(test("a, b, c, d, e, f, g, h,", char_ % ',', space, false));
- }
- {
- std::string s;
- BOOST_TEST(test_attr("a,b,c,d,e,f,g,h", char_ % ',', s));
- BOOST_TEST(s == "abcdefgh");
- BOOST_TEST(!test("a,b,c,d,e,f,g,h,", char_ % ','));
- }
- {
- std::string s;
- BOOST_TEST(test_attr("ab,cd,ef,gh", (char_ >> char_) % ',', s));
- BOOST_TEST(s == "abcdefgh");
- BOOST_TEST(!test("ab,cd,ef,gh,", (char_ >> char_) % ','));
- BOOST_TEST(!test("ab,cd,ef,g", (char_ >> char_) % ','));
- s.clear();
- BOOST_TEST(test_attr("ab,cd,efg", (char_ >> char_) % ',' >> char_, s));
- BOOST_TEST(s == "abcdefg");
- }
- {
- using boost::spirit::x3::int_;
- std::vector<int> v;
- BOOST_TEST(test_attr("1,2", int_ % ',', v));
- BOOST_TEST(2 == v.size() && 1 == v[0] && 2 == v[1]);
- }
- {
- using boost::spirit::x3::int_;
- std::vector<int> v;
- BOOST_TEST(test_attr("(1,2)", '(' >> int_ % ',' >> ')', v));
- BOOST_TEST(2 == v.size() && 1 == v[0] && 2 == v[1]);
- }
- {
- std::vector<std::string> v;
- BOOST_TEST(test_attr("a,b,c,d", +alpha % ',', v));
- BOOST_TEST(4 == v.size() && "a" == v[0] && "b" == v[1]
- && "c" == v[2] && "d" == v[3]);
- }
- {
- std::vector<boost::optional<char> > v;
- BOOST_TEST(test_attr("#a,#", ('#' >> -alpha) % ',', v));
- BOOST_TEST(2 == v.size() &&
- !!v[0] && 'a' == boost::get<char>(v[0]) && !v[1]);
- std::vector<char> v2;
- BOOST_TEST(test_attr("#a,#", ('#' >> -alpha) % ',', v2));
- BOOST_TEST(1 == v2.size() && 'a' == v2[0]);
- }
- { // actions
- using boost::spirit::x3::_attr;
- std::string s;
- auto f = [&](auto& ctx){ s = std::string(_attr(ctx).begin(), _attr(ctx).end()); };
- BOOST_TEST(test("a,b,c,d,e,f,g,h", (char_ % ',')[f]));
- BOOST_TEST(s == "abcdefgh");
- }
- { // test move only types
- std::vector<move_only> v;
- BOOST_TEST(test_attr("s.s.s.s", synth_move_only % '.', v));
- BOOST_TEST_EQ(v.size(), 4);
- }
- return boost::report_errors();
- }
